A miscarriage can result from different causes, but the most common one is a hormonal inadequacy; various hormones and enzymes are required in order to support pregnancy, and when they are lacking the first thing observed are symptoms like vaginal bleeding or even spotting (symptoms can also depend on the stage of pregnancy), abdominal cramps, etc.

Once symptoms are seen, the next thing that takes place is the expulsion of the contents of conception (whose presentation again depends on the age of the pregnancy). In early stages, all you will observe is bleeding, but in later stages parts of conception can also be seen.

Once the contents of conception are expelled the symptoms can last for a while longer, especially bleeding but will gradually subside. A miscarriage is considered complete once the contents are conception are expelled.
